This group was inspired by one of the best groups on Flickr, One Object 365 Days Project.
30 Days, One Object is for those who love objects but have commitment issues (one whole year with the same object freaks you out), those with decision making issues (so many objects, so little time), and those who would like to explore objects with expiration dates (produce, flowers, use your imagination).
Here are the rules:
1. Take one photograph of the same object every day. The object can be anything (family-friendly please) such as a pet, a toy, a tree... just make sure it's the same object every day. No stand-ins or substitutes. Be as creative as you like with backgrounds, locations, etc. You can start your project on any day, it does not have to start at the beginning of the month.
2. Label and tag: Each photo should have a number and date (1/30 11-30-08) in the description or title. The date you specify should match the date in the photo's data (in other words, no cheating). Please tag your photo "30 Days, One Object ".
3. Post your picture to the group pool. If you have been taking pictures but are behind in uploading, go ahead and post them but no more than three at a time.
4. Be consistent. This is a group for commitment-phobes and the indecisive, but let's try to work on our issues! Life gets in the way, and this is understandable. If you miss a day or two, just pick up where you left off (thereby extending your project a couple of days) and just continue to 30.
5. Commenting on other photos in the group is not required, but would be nice. Be kind and spread good Karma.
6. Make a Mosaic! When you have completed the 30 days, head on over to Big Huge Labs Mosaic Maker and make a mosaic of your project. Post it to the completed objects thread in the discussions.
7. Have fun!
